The state of Colorado does hereby pledge to and covenant and <br />agree with the holders of any bonds or notes issued pursuant to the powers <br />set forth in this article that the state will not limit or alter the rights or powers <br />vested by this article in the authority to acquire, construct, maintain, <br />improve, repair I and operate the project in any way that would jeopardize <br />the interest of such holders, or to perform and fulfill the terms of any agree- <br />ment made with the holders of such bonds or notes, or to fix, establish, <br />charge, and collect such rents, fees, rates, or other charges as may be con- <br />venient or necessary to produce sufficient revenues to meet all expenses of <br />the authority and fulfill the terms of any agreement made with the holders <br />of such bonds and notes, together with interest thereon, with interest on any <br />unpaid installments of interest, and all costs and expenses in connection with <br />any action or proceedings by or on behalf of such holders, until the bonds, <br />together with interest thereon, are fully met and discharged or provided for. <br /> <br />37-95-115, Exemption 01 bonds 'rom taxation, Any bonds issued by the <br />authority under the provisions of this article. their transfer, and the inl;ome <br />therefrom (including any profit made on the sale thereof) shall at all limes <br />be free from taxation by the state or any political subdivision or other instru- <br />mentality of the state. <br /> <br />37-95-116. Annual report - annual audit - annual budget. On or before <br />the last day of August in each year, the authority shall make an annual report <br />of its activities for the preceding fiscal year to the governor, the Colorado <br />water conservation board, and the general assembly. Each such report shall <br />set forth a complete operating and financial statement covering its operations <br />during the year. Included within such report shall be detailed financial data <br />setting forth the manner in which any previously appropriated state funds <br />have been used. Further, the authority shall include in its report any requests <br />for state funds for the upcoming state fiscal year, detailing the purposes for <br />which said funds are to be utilized. The authority shall cause an audit of <br />its books and accounts to be made at least once in each year by certified. <br />public accountants, and the cost thereof shall be considered as expenses of <br />the authority, and a copy thereof shall be filed with the state treasurer. In <br />addition. the authority shall develop and adopt an annual budget and submit <br />such budget on a timely basis to each district. governmental, and other enti- <br />ties participating in projects, so as to permit such districts and entities to <br />make necessary adjustments in their respective budgets, fees, and charges. <br /> <br />37-95-117. Services by state officers, departments, boards, agencies, divi- <br />sions, and commissions. All officers, departments, boards, agencies, divisions, <br />and commissions of the state are hereby authorized and empowered to render <br />any and all of such serv\ces to the authority as may be within the area of <br />their -respective governmental functions as fixed or established by law and <br />as may be requested by the authority.
